I was hired to commission and edit three sf short-shorts for the special Invisible Planet (the Science we Don't see) double issue of Discover Magazine.

It's out now, with 1,000 word stories by Bruce Sterling and Paul McAuley. Cory Doctorow's story will be in a future issue.
